Decoding Post-Transcriptional Regulation with miRNA-Seq

microRNAs (miRNAs) are small, non-coding RNA molecules that play important roles in regulating gene expression at the post-transcriptional level. miRNA sequencing allows researchers to measure the abundance of miRNAs in a sample and to compare the miRNA expression levels between different samples.

Input Requirements
  • ≥ 2 μg of total RNA or ≥ 10 ng of exosomal RNA

  • A260/280 = 1.8-2.0

  • A260/230 ≥ 1.8
